The story follows Will Stronghold (Michael Angarano), the son of legendary superheroes The Commander (Kurt Russell) and Jetstream (Kelly Preston). Expected to inherit great powers, Will instead discovers he’s a “sidekick” — possessing enhanced agility and balance but no flashy super-strength. Sent to Sky High, a high school for teenage superheroes and sidekicks, Will must navigate cliques (Heroes vs. Sidekicks), first love (Gwen Grayson, played by Mary Elizabeth Winstead), and his own expectations while a sinister plot unfolds involving a villainous teacher and a plan that puts the school and the world at risk.
